Water-themed Names For Boys

Choosing a name for your baby boy can be a daunting task, but finding a name with a special meaning can make the decision a little bit easier. If you’re looking for a unique and meaningful name for your little one, why not consider a water-themed name? Water is a powerful and essential element, and it has long been associated with purity, life, and tranquility. Whether you’re drawn to the ocean, rivers, or lakes, here are some water-themed names that are sure to make a splash!

1. River: This name is strong and masculine, and it evokes images of flowing water and the tranquility of nature. It’s a popular choice for parents who want a name that is both unique and meaningful.

2. Ocean: If you want a name that is bold and majestic, Ocean is a great choice. This name represents the vastness and power of the sea, and it is perfect for parents who want a name that is as unique as their little one.

3. Kai: This Hawaiian name means “sea” or “ocean” and is a popular choice for parents who want a name that is short, yet meaningful. Kai has a simple and elegant sound, and it’s a great option for parents who want a name that is both unique and easy to pronounce.

4. Dylan: Dylan is a Welsh name that means “son of the sea.” It’s a strong and powerful name that is perfect for parents who want a name that reflects the strength and beauty of the ocean.

5. Finn: This Irish name means “fair” or “white,” and it is often associated with water. Finn is a popular choice for parents who want a name that is both strong and gentle, and it’s a great option for parents who want a name that is easy to spell and pronounce.

Ocean Names

If you’re looking for a unique and water-themed name for your baby boy, consider choosing an ocean-inspired name. These names are not only beautiful but also have a deep connection to the vastness and mystery of the ocean. Here are some ocean names that you might like:

1. Finn: This Irish name means “fair,” and it is also associated with the ocean. It is a perfect name for a boy who is adventurous and loves the water.

2. Kai: Kai is a Hawaiian name that means “ocean.” It is a popular name for boys and has a strong, masculine sound to it.

3. Jonah: Jonah is a Hebrew name that means “dove.” In the Bible, Jonah was swallowed by a whale, which gives this name a strong oceanic connection.

4. Marin: Marin is a name of Latin origin that means “of the sea.” It is a unisex name and can be used for both boys and girls.

5. Rio: Rio is a Spanish name that means “river.” While it is not directly related to the ocean, it has a water-themed meaning and is a unique choice for a baby boy’s name.

6. Cove: Cove is an English word and name that refers to a small sheltered bay along the coast. It is a simple yet beautiful name that brings to mind images of the ocean.

7. Azure: Azure is a name that means “sky blue.” It evokes the color of the clear blue ocean and is a unique choice for a baby boy’s name.

8. Triton: Triton is a name from Greek mythology and is the son of Poseidon, the god of the sea. It is a powerful and majestic name for a baby boy.

9. Caspian: Caspian is a name that comes from the Caspian Sea, which is the largest enclosed inland body of water on Earth. It is a distinguished name with a strong connection to the ocean.

10. Oceanus: Oceanus is a name from Greek mythology and represents the world-ocean, a huge body of water that encircles the Earth. It is a grand and unique name for a baby boy.

These ocean names have a sense of adventure and tranquility that is perfect for a baby boy. Whether you are drawn to the power and mystery of the ocean or simply love the beauty of its waters, these names are sure to make a memorable choice for your little one.

River Names

River inspired names carry a sense of strength and flow, making them a perfect choice for a boy’s name.

1. Hudson: This name brings to mind the mighty Hudson River in New York, known for its historic importance and scenic beauty.

2. Nile: Named after the famous Nile River that flows through several African countries, this name symbolizes power and abundance.

3. Jordan: Inspired by the Jordan River, this name carries spiritual significance and represents purification.

4. Rio: Meaning “river” in Spanish and Portuguese, this name has a vibrant and lively feel.

5. Thames: This name is derived from the iconic River Thames in London, known for its cultural significance and picturesque views.

6. Tyne: Named after the River Tyne in England, this name signifies strength and resilience.

7. Danube: Inspired by the majestic Danube River that flows through several European countries, this name evokes a sense of adventure and wanderlust.

8. Rhys: Derived from the Welsh word for “enthusiasm” or “passion,” this name is associated with the flowing energy of a river.

9. Indus: This name comes from the Indus River in Asia, symbolizing a rich cultural heritage and vitality.

10. Amazon: Inspired by the mighty Amazon River in South America, this name represents strength, diversity, and natural beauty.

Brook Names

If you’re looking for a unique and nature-inspired name for your baby boy, consider choosing a name that is associated with brooks and streams. These names evoke the peaceful and serene qualities of flowing water, and can make a beautiful choice for your little one. Here are some brook-themed names for boys that you might find appealing:

1. River: A popular choice for parents who want a water-inspired name, River brings to mind the gentle and constant flow of a brook.

2. Brooks: This name is a direct reference to small streams and brooks, and has a rustic and charming feel to it.

3. Lake: While not specifically a brook, Lake is a water-themed name that invokes a sense of calm and tranquility.

4. Ford: This name is associated with shallow water areas in a river or brook, and signifies strength and endurance.

5. Cascade: A cascade is a series of small waterfalls, and this name brings to mind the beauty and power of flowing water.

6. Reed: While not directly related to brooks, Reed is a plant that is often found near bodies of water, adding a touch of nature to this name.

7. Murdock: This name has Celtic origins and means “protector of the sea”, making it a strong and meaningful water-themed choice.

8. Beck: Derived from the Old Norse word “bekkr” meaning “brook”, this name has a simple and understated charm.

9. Bay: Although more commonly associated with larger bodies of water, Bay can also evoke the image of a peaceful inlet or small bay.

10. Brookfield: This name combines the serene imagery of a brook with the English word “field”, creating a name that is both nature-inspired and strong.

These brook-themed names for boys offer a range of options, from subtle nods to flowing water to more direct references. Whether you’re drawn to the peacefulness of a brook or the power of a waterfall, there is a name on this list that is sure to be the perfect fit for your baby boy.

Wave Names

Wave names are a popular choice for parents who are looking for water-themed names for their baby boys. These names are associated with the power, strength, and beauty of the ocean waves. Here are some unique wave names that you can consider:

Name Meaning
Oceanus A Greek mythological god of the ocean
Kai A Hawaiian name meaning “sea”
Marlon A name of English origin meaning “little falcon by the sea”
Wade A name of English origin meaning “at the river crossing”
Dylan A name of Welsh origin meaning “son of the sea”
Skyler A name of Dutch origin meaning “scholar by the water”
Arlo A name of English origin meaning “fortified hill by the water”
Nereus A Greek mythological god of the sea
Brooks A name of English origin meaning “a stream”
Harbor A name of English origin meaning “a sheltered place along the coast”

These wave names are not only meaningful but also have a strong and powerful sound to them. They are perfect for parents who want to give their baby boy a name that reflects the beauty and force of the ocean waves.
